Output 62e2e169016583e32fd24e60f000e7c3a2d5d194cfa0c07fd1e51c6c59181919:1

value
3944620
script pubkey
OP_0 OP_PUSHBYTES_20 fbbc85daad659dcd5b093bea9a963427f3c246d7
address
ltc1qlw7gtk4dvkwu6kcf804f4935yleuy3kh5refkj
transaction
62e2e169016583e32fd24e60f000e7c3a2d5d194cfa0c07fd1e51c6c59181919
spent
true